前言:"改助记词"在区块链钱包中并不是直接修改原有助记词的操作。助记词是生成私钥的根源,无法修改同一钱包对应的助记词。常见做法是创建或恢复一个新钱包(新助记词),然后将资产从旧钱包迁移到新钱包。以下给出详细步骤与风险控制,并就安全合作、新兴技术(含同态加密)、行业未来、交易成功要点和账户安全性做分析。
核心概念说明
1) 助记词不可变:BIP-39 助记词用于生成私钥,不能被“更改”。要更换,就必须创建一个新的助记词对应的新钱包地址并转移资产。
2) 私钥与地址:同一助记词下的地址在不同设备上可导入,但助记词本身无法替换已存在地址的根密钥。
详细操作步骤(以 TokenPocket 为例)
一、准备工作
- 备份现有助记词和私钥(截图不要云存储),写在纸上并多处保存。确保无恶意软件环境。
- 记录所有代币合约、自定义代币和授权信息(approve)。
二、创建新钱包(新助记词)
1. 打开 TPWallet,选择“创建钱包”或“创建多链钱包”。
2. 按提示生成助记词,按顺序抄写并保存在安全地点。可设置 BIP39 passphrase(额外密码)以增加安全。
3. 完成助记词验证,给新钱包命名并设置密码/指纹解锁。
三、迁移资产(推荐步骤)
1. 在旧钱包中,先做小额测试转账(少量主链币,如 0.0001 ETH 或相应网络代币),确认收款地址正确并能到账。
2. 在新钱包中复制对应链的接收地址,注意不同链的地址格式与跨链桥并非直接转账。
3. 将代币从旧钱包逐一转到新钱包:先主链资产,再 ERC-20/代币,注意交易手续费与网络拥堵。
4. 对于 DeFi 头寸、质押和智能合约托管的资产,先解除或退出(若必要),避免直接转出造成损失。
5. 转移完成并确认后,建议在 Etherscan/BscScan 等区块链浏览器核对交易和余额。
四、清理与撤销授权
- 使用链上工具(如 revoke.cash 或区块链浏览器的“Revoke”功能)撤销旧钱包对合约的授权,避免被滥用。
- 如不再使用旧钱包,可在本地删除应用钱包(确保已备份且确认迁移完成)。
五、额外安全建议
- 尽量在离线或干净系统上创建助记词;考虑使用硬件钱包并结合 TPWallet 的硬件签名功能。
- 不要在截图或云端保存助记词;多地物理备份(防火防水信封、保险箱)。
- 使用 BIP39 passphrase(额外密码)能显著提升安全,但需谨慎保存该密码。
交易成功要点(提高成功率)
- 确认网络/链选择正确,检查 nonce、gas 费、slippage(滑点)和链的拥堵情况。


- 小额先行实验,使用可靠 RPC 节点或官方节点,避免被中间人篡改交易数据。
- 对复杂合约交互,查看源代码或审计报告,谨慎批准代币授权。
安全合作与行业生态
- 钱包厂商、交易所和审计机构需加强协作:共享威胁情报、快速响应钓鱼与恶意 dApp。
- 社区和第三方工具(如交易仲裁、黑名单服务)能帮助发现和阻断异常交易。
新兴技术应用与同态加密
- 同态加密允许在加密数据上直接进行运算,理论上可用于构建隐私计算服务(例如在不泄露账户余额详情的前提下提供信贷评分或风控)。
- 但签名操作(私钥签名交易)仍需私钥明文或安全签名环境(如安全元件、硬件钱包、阈值签名)。同态加密并不能直接替代私钥的签名功能。
- 更实用的前沿方向为多方计算(MPC)、阈值签名(TSS)、零知识证明(ZK)与账户抽象(Account Abstraction),这些技术可在不暴露单一私钥的前提下实现安全签名、社交恢复与可编程账户策略。
行业未来展望
- 钱包将从单一助记词向多重保护、社交恢复、硬件+软件混合签名转变;并与链上身份、合规与隐私保护技术结合。
- MPC/阈值签名和硬件安全模块将成为主流,提供更高可用性与企业级密钥管理。
账户安全性总结建议
- 永远备份助记词并离线存储,考虑 BIP39 passphrase。
- 使用硬件钱包或受信任的阈值签名服务处理大额资产。
- 定期撤销不必要的合约授权,使用白名单和交易审计工具。
- 在迁移或更换助记词时,务必先做小额测试并确认链上记录,避免一键操作造成不可逆损失。
结语:更换助记词的正确流程是创建新钱包并安全迁移资产,而不是修改原有助记词。结合硬件、MPC/阈值签名、合约撤销和良好操作习惯,可以在提升便捷性的同时显著提高账户安全性。
评论
CryptoLeo
讲得很清楚,特别是小额测试和撤销授权这两点,避免踩雷。
区块小王
同态加密部分解释到位,没想到它不能直接替代签名。
AnnaWallet
BIP39 passphrase 强烈推荐,实战中救过我一次。
链安研究员
建议再补充硬件钱包与 MPC 的对比场景,适合不同用户群体。
小明
操作步骤一目了然,按步骤迁移后账户很安心。
SatoshiFan
行业未来分析有见地,期待更多关于阈值签名的应用案例。